Impact of Staphylococcus aureus colonization and skin abscesses on formation of human anti-αGal antibodiesNARA Subscribed
IgG antibodies against terminal galactose-α-1,3-galactose (anti-αGal antibodies) are naturally occurring in humans, but their origins remain poorly understood. These antibodies target various microorganisms including Staphylococcus aureus , a common nasal commensal and the major cause of skin abscesses. Carbon dioxide activated biochars as mediators for reductive debromination of 1,2-dibromoethaneNARA Subscribed
The fuel additive and pesticide 1,2-dibromoethane (DBA) is a problematic organic pollutant found in soil and aquifers. Remediation methods face drawbacks because of undesirable by-products and slow rates of removal. Biochars (BCs) are catalysts of reductive dehalogenation in anoxic environments by the layered iron(II)-iron(III) hydroxide green rust (GR).
